Whether the dragon blood tree can bloom, the answer is yes. Although the flowering phenomenon of dragon blood trees is rare, it is not impossible. Under suitable conditions, dragon blood trees can bloom. Its flowers are usually yellow or white and have unique shapes., have certain ornamental value. Conditions for dragonblood trees to bloom 1. Lighting: dragonblood trees like to scatter light. Direct sunlight may easily cause burns to the leaves. When maintaining indoors, they should be placed in a place with bright light but no direct sunlight.

2. Temperature: The suitable temperature for the growth of Dragon Blood Tree is 18-28℃. Too high or too low temperature will affect its flowering.

3. Moisture: Maintaining moisture in the soil is the key to the growth of Dragon Blood Tree. Too much or too little moisture will affect its growth and flowering.

4. Fertilizer: During the growing season, appropriate application of compound fertilizers can promote the growth and flowering of Dragon Blood Tree. Dragon's blood tree maintenance tips 1. Choose the right container: Dragon's blood tree is suitable for growing in containers with good air permeability. Avoid using too tight containers to avoid affecting root growth.

2. Watering in a timely manner: Keep the soil slightly moist and avoid standing water. When high temperatures in summer, the watering frequency can be increased appropriately; when low temperatures in winter, watering should be reduced.

3. Fertilization: During the growing season, apply compound fertilizers once a month to promote growth and flowering.

4. Clean the leaves: Wipe the leaves regularly with a damp cloth to keep the leaves bright and also facilitate photosynthesis.
